Re: Trailers, trucks, and cars, oh my!



We Bought a retired school bus for ~1K and insured it for about the same. The hard part was getting a driver so i went an got a CDL.

We took out the 3 back seats and put in a safety cage.
This summer we want to paint the bumpers red and put our # on them. I believe there is talk of upgrading the sound system as well.

We were very fortunate to have a trailer donated to us several years ago, and another sponsor donated the vinyl wrap that makes it look so cool.

For our travel to Atlanta 2 years ago, and Virginia last year, we rented a Sprinter Van from a local rental agency. We convinced them to give us a break on the mileage charge as sponsors of the team - they were very nice about it.

The Sprinter gets about 27 MPG on Diesel at 65 MPH, can easily carry 3 or 4 teams' worth of stuff, has a high roof (over 7') and really wide doors. I think for Virgina it cost us a few hundred dollars, most of that being mileage costs, so for a closer competition it may be quite reasonable.

We actually rented the 10' truck. The final price wasn't as bad as we had feared, but it was still more than we could have hoped for. Of course, that was after Budget bailed on us with 4 hours to go before we were to pick up the truck.

Part of what we are trying to do is to eliminate reliance on the mentor/parent vehicles. All of the mentor vehicles that could tow a trailer are unreliable enough to give us, in the words of King Julian, the "heebie-jeebies". The one mentor that we used to use the minivan of is moving too far away at the end of the school year.
